Ultrafree®-MC (0.5 mL) and Ultrafree®-CL (2 mL) centrifugal devices are single-use, disposable filters used for removing particulates from aqueous biological solutions. These devices are available in two processing volumes with a range of microporous membranes (from 0.1 to 5.0 µm) for fast filtration and highly reproducible performance. Pre-sterilized units are also available. Use in fixed-angle rotors for 1.5 mL tubes (-MC) and 15 mL tubes (–CL).•Five different pore sizes from 0.1 to 5.0 µm •Pre-sterilized units also available •Fast filtration and highly reproducible performance •Use in fixed-angle rotors for 1.5 mL tubes Applications•Removal of particles and precipitates from aqueous and some solvent-based samples •Ideal for use with protein and nucleic acid solutions

Durapore® membranes provide high flow rates and throughput, low extractables and broad chemical compatibility. Hydrophlic Durapore® membrane binds far less protein than nylon, nitrocellulose, or PTFE membranes.Features & Benefits - Available in several pore sizes (both hydrophilic and hydrophobic varieties) to suit your application needs - Durapore® membrane filters have very low protein binding to minimize interaction with your sample and maximize recovery
